2503 Rockingham Dr is listed for sale at $ 2,395,000. The Residential Single Family property has 6 bedrooms, 5 Full Bathrooms, 2100 square feet and was built in 1959. The lot size is 9513.5 Square feet. BRLocated in the heart of Barton Hills, 2503 Rockingham Drive presents a renovation where modern design, functional layout, and flexibility come together within one of Austin’s most sought-after 78704 settings. The single-story main residence includes four bedrooms and three full bathrooms, thoughtfully reimagined with a clean, contemporary aesthetic. Vaulted ceilings with exposed beams, wide-plank hardwood flooring, and well-placed windows create a bright, open environment, while natural materials and understated finishes bring warmth and balance throughout. The layout allows for a seamless flow between living, dining, and kitchen spaces, well-suited for both daily routines and social moments. The kitchen sits at the center of the home, featuring custom cabinetry, quartz countertops, an oversized island with seating, and stainless appliances. The space is elevated by thoughtful finishes, allowing it to remain integrated with the surrounding spaces. Positioned beyond the main residence, a newly constructed two-story ADU introduces versatility, with two bedrooms and two bathrooms. Designed to complement the main home’s modern aesthetic, the structure incorporates wood accents and metal cladding while maintaining a cohesive feel. Light carries consistently throughout, and the separation between structures creates a distinct yet connected living environment. The layout is well-suited for guest accommodations, multi-generational living, or a private office or studio setup. Outdoor spaces are equally considered, with a covered patio and open lawn creating indoor-outdoor flow. The lot also allows for future enhancements, including the addition of a pool while maintaining usable yard space. Set within Barton Hills, the property is just minutes from Zilker Park, Barton Springs, and the South Lamar corridor—placing some of Austin’s most established amenities nearby while maintaining a residential setting.
